Calculateur d’Évolution sur Excel
Calculez facilement le taux d’évolution entre deux valeurs avec notre outil précis
Guide Complet : Comment Calculer une Évolution sur Excel
Le calcul d’évolution entre deux valeurs est une opération fondamentale en analyse de données, que ce soit pour évaluer la croissance d’une entreprise, analyser des tendances économiques ou suivre des performances financières. Ce guide complet vous expliquera comment maîtriser ces calculs dans Excel, avec des méthodes adaptées à différents scénarios professionnels.
1. Comprendre les Concepts de Base
Avant de plonger dans les formules Excel, il est essentiel de comprendre les concepts mathématiques sous-jacents :
- Valeur initiale (V₁) : Point de départ de votre mesure
- Valeur finale (V₂) : Point d’arrivée de votre mesure
- Taux d’évolution : Variation relative entre V₁ et V₂, exprimée en pourcentage
- Valeur absolue : Différence numérique entre V₂ et V₁
- Taux annuel équivalent : Standardisation du taux pour une comparaison annualisée
2. Formules Excel Essentielles
Excel offre plusieurs méthodes pour calculer les évolutions. Voici les formules les plus utiles :
2.1 Calcul de la variation absolue
La formule la plus simple pour obtenir la différence entre deux valeurs :
=V₂ - V₁
Exemple : Si A1 contient 1500 et B1 contient 1800, la formule =B1-A1 retournera 300.
2.2 Calcul du taux d’évolution en pourcentage
Pour obtenir le pourcentage de variation :
=((V₂ - V₁) / V₁) * 100
Dans Excel, cela se traduit par :
=((B1-A1)/A1)*100
N’oubliez pas de formater le résultat en pourcentage (Ctrl+Shift+%)
2.3 Calcul du taux annuel équivalent
Pour annualiser un taux de variation sur une période différente :
=((V₂/V₁)^(1/n))-1
Où n représente le nombre d’années. Par exemple, pour une évolution sur 5 ans :
=((B1/A1)^(1/5))-1
3. Méthodes Avancées
3.1 Utilisation des fonctions Excel dédiées
Excel propose des fonctions spécifiques pour les calculs d’évolution :
| Fonction | Syntaxe | Description | Exemple |
|---|---|---|---|
| POURCENTAGE.VARIATION | =POURCENTAGE.VARIATION(vieille_valeur; nouvelle_valeur) | Calcule le pourcentage de variation entre deux nombres | =POURCENTAGE.VARIATION(A1;B1) |
| TAUX.CROISSANCE | =TAUX.CROISSANCE(valeurs_conues; valeurs_variables) | Calcule le taux de croissance exponentielle | =TAUX.CROISSANCE(A1:A5;B1:B5) |
| PREVISION.ETS | =PREVISION.ETS(cible; timeline; valeurs; [saisonnalité]) | Prédit une valeur future basée sur des données existantes | =PREVISION.ETS(12;A1:A10;B1:B10) |
3.2 Analyse de séries temporelles
Pour analyser des évolutions sur plusieurs périodes :
- Organisez vos données en colonnes (Date | Valeur)
- Calculez les variations périodiques :
=((B3-B2)/B2)*100
- Utilisez des graphiques en courbes pour visualiser les tendances
- Appliquez une régression linéaire avec la fonction
=DROITEREG()
3.3 Calculs avec dates
Pour des calculs basés sur des intervalles de temps précis :
=((V₂-V₁)/V₁)*365/(date_fin-date_début)
Cette formule annualise le taux de variation en fonction du nombre exact de jours entre deux dates.
4. Visualisation des Évolution
La visualisation est cruciale pour communiquer efficacement les évolutions. Voici les meilleurs types de graphiques selon le contexte :
| Type de données | Graphique recommandé | Avantages | Exemple d’utilisation |
|---|---|---|---|
| Évolution sur longue période | Courbe lissée | Montre clairement les tendances générales | Croissance du PIB sur 20 ans |
| Comparaison de plusieurs séries | Graphique en aires | Permet de visualiser les parts relatives | Parts de marché de différents produits |
| Variations rapides | Graphique en colonnes groupées | Montre bien les écarts entre périodes | Ventes mensuelles par région |
| Taux de croissance | Graphique à barres flottantes | Met en évidence les variations positives/négatives | Performance boursière annuelle |
5. Pièges à Éviter
Même les utilisateurs expérimentés commettent parfois ces erreurs :
- Division par zéro : Toujours vérifier que la valeur initiale n’est pas nulle
- Mauvaise interprétation des pourcentages : Une baisse de 50% suivie d’une hausse de 50% ne revient pas au point de départ
- Oublier l’annualisation : Comparer des taux sur des périodes différentes sans ajustement
- Confondre valeur absolue et relative : Une augmentation de 100€ n’a pas le même impact si la valeur initiale est 200€ ou 2000€
- Négliger l’inflation : Pour les analyses économiques, toujours ajuster les valeurs en termes réels
6. Études de Cas Pratiques
6.1 Analyse de croissance d’entreprise
Prenons l’exemple d’une PME avec les chiffres suivants :
| Année | Chiffre d’affaires (k€) | Variation absolue | Taux de croissance |
|---|---|---|---|
| 2020 | 1250 | – | – |
| 2021 | 1430 | 180 | 14.4% |
| 2022 | 1720 | 290 | 20.3% |
| 2023 | 1980 | 260 | 15.1% |
Formules utilisées :
- Variation absolue :
=B3-B2 - Taux de croissance :
=((B3-B2)/B2)*100 - Croissance annualisée (CAGR) :
=((B5/B2)^(1/3))-1→ 19.8%
6.2 Analyse de performance boursière
Pour un portefeuille d’actions avec les données suivantes :
| Date | Valeur (€) | Variation quotidienne | Variation % |
|---|---|---|---|
| 01/01/2023 | 15420 | – | – |
| 02/01/2023 | 15580 | 160 | 1.04% |
| 03/01/2023 | 15490 | -90 | -0.58% |
| 04/01/2023 | 15720 | 230 | 1.48% |
Formules avancées pour ce cas :
- Volatilité :
=ECARTYPE.P(C2:C5) - Rendement annualisé :
=((15720/15420)^(365/3))-1→ 14.3% - Drawdown maximum :
=MIN((B2:B5-MAX(B$2:B2))/MAX(B$2:B2))
7. Automatisation avec VBA
Pour les utilisateurs avancés, voici un exemple de macro VBA qui calcule automatiquement les évolutions pour une plage sélectionnée :
Sub CalculerEvolutions()
Dim rng As Range
Dim cell As Range
Dim initialValue As Double
Dim finalValue As Double
Dim evolution As Double
' Sélectionner la plage de données (colonne B par exemple)
Set rng = Selection
' Vérifier que la sélection est dans une seule colonne
If rng.Columns.Count > 1 Then
MsgBox "Veuillez sélectionner une seule colonne de valeurs", vbExclamation
Exit Sub
End If
' Créer des en-têtes pour les résultats
rng.Parent.Cells(1, rng.Column + 1).Value = "Variation absolue"
rng.Parent.Cells(1, rng.Column + 2).Value = "Taux d'évolution (%)"
' Calculer les évolutions
For i = 2 To rng.Rows.Count
initialValue = rng.Cells(i - 1, 1).Value
finalValue = rng.Cells(i, 1).Value
' Variation absolue
rng.Cells(i, rng.Column + 1).Value = finalValue - initialValue
' Taux d'évolution
If initialValue <> 0 Then
rng.Cells(i, rng.Column + 2).Value = ((finalValue - initialValue) / initialValue) * 100
rng.Cells(i, rng.Column + 2).NumberFormat = "0.00%"
Else
rng.Cells(i, rng.Column + 2).Value = "N/A"
End If
Next i
' Ajuster la largeur des colonnes
rng.Parent.Columns(rng.Column + 1).AutoFit
rng.Parent.Columns(rng.Column + 2).AutoFit
MsgBox "Calcul des évolutions terminé!", vbInformation
End Sub
Pour utiliser cette macro :
- Appuyez sur Alt+F11 pour ouvrir l’éditeur VBA
- Insérez un nouveau module (Insertion > Module)
- Copiez-collez le code ci-dessus
- Sélectionnez vos données dans Excel
- Exécutez la macro (F5 ou via le menu Macro)
8. Bonnes Pratiques Professionnelles
Pour des analyses d’évolution professionnelles :
- Documentation : Toujours commenter vos formules et créer une légende
- Vérification : Utiliser des cellules de contrôle pour valider vos calculs
- Visualisation : Associer toujours des graphiques à vos tableaux de données
- Benchmarking : Comparer vos résultats avec des références sectorielles
- Mise à jour : Automatiser la mise à jour des données avec Power Query
- Sécurité : Protéger les cellules contenant des formules importantes
9. Alternatives à Excel
Bien qu’Excel soit l’outil le plus courant, d’autres solutions existent :
| Outil | Avantages | Inconvénients | Cas d’usage idéal |
|---|---|---|---|
| Google Sheets | Collaboration en temps réel, gratuit, intégrations cloud | Fonctions avancées limitées, performances sur grands jeux de données | Travail d’équipe, analyses simples |
| Python (Pandas) | Puissance de calcul, automatisation, visualisations avancées | Courbe d’apprentissage, nécessite des compétences en programmation | Big Data, analyses répétitives |
| R | Statistiques avancées, visualisations publication-ready | Syntaxe complexe, moins adapté aux tableaux simples | Recherche académique, modélisation statistique |
| Tableau/Power BI | Visualisations interactives, tableaux de bord dynamiques | Coût élevé, courbe d’apprentissage pour les fonctions avancées | Reporting exécutif, analyse exploratoire |
10. Conclusion et Prochaines Étapes
Maîtriser le calcul des évolutions dans Excel est une compétence essentielle pour tout professionnel travaillant avec des données. Voici comment progresser :
- Pratique : Utilisez notre calculateur en haut de page pour tester différents scénarios
- Approfondissement : Explorez les fonctions
PREVISION.ETSetTENDANCEpour des prévisions - Automatisation : Apprenez à créer des tableaux croisés dynamiques pour analyser des séries temporelles
- Visualisation : Expérimentez avec les graphiques sparklines pour des visualisations compactes
- Certification : Envisagez une certification Microsoft Excel (MO-200 ou MO-201)
Rappelez-vous que la clé d’une bonne analyse réside dans :
- La qualité des données d’entrée
- La pertinence des méthodes choisies
- La clarté de la présentation des résultats
- La capacité à en tirer des insights actionnables
En combinant les techniques présentées dans ce guide avec notre calculateur interactif, vous serez équipé pour effectuer des analyses d’évolution professionnelles, que ce soit pour des rapports financiers, des études de marché ou des suivis de performance.